1. Ballistic Characteristics

Ballistic performance hinges on bullet weight, powder load, and barrel length. Subsonic loads typically fire 220‑240 grain projectiles at around 1,050 ft/s, delivering reliable energy while remaining below the sound barrier. Supersonic loads can push 110‑125 grain bullets beyond 2,300 ft/s, matching traditional 5.56 mm performance. The ability to switch between these regimes without changing the firearm’s bolt or magazine simplifies logistics.

4. Tactical Flexibility

The cartridge’s design permits rapid transition between subsonic and supersonic loads by merely swapping magazines. This flexibility supports mission‑specific loadouts without additional equipment. For instance, a tactical team can load half of its magazines with subsonic rounds for stealth phases and the other half with supersonic rounds for open‑field engagements.

Furthermore, the cartridge’s compatibility with standard AR‑15 lower receivers means existing inventories of rifles, optics, and accessories remain usable, minimizing acquisition costs while expanding operational capabilities.

Question 1: How does subsonic 300 AAC differ from standard 5.56 mm?

Subsonic 300 AAC fires heavier bullets at velocities below the sound barrier, delivering similar energy at short ranges while producing far less audible and visual signature, making it ideal for stealth operations.

Question 2: Can a standard AR‑15 fire 300 AAC without modifications?

Yes, a standard AR‑15 lower receiver accepts 300 AAC magazines, but optimal reliability often requires a barrel and gas system tuned for the cartridge’s pressure profile.

Question 3: What suppressor types work best with subsonic loads?

Compact, multi‑baffle suppressors designed for subsonic pressures provide the greatest sound reduction, as they need only mitigate propellant noise without addressing a sonic crack.

Question 4: Is 300 AAC suitable for long‑range shooting?

Supersonic loads with high‑BC bullets can achieve accurate results out to 600 meters, though the cartridge is primarily valued for its versatility rather than extreme range performance.

Question 5: How does recoil compare to 5.56 mm?

Recoil is generally lower due to the heavier bullet and slower velocity, allowing faster follow‑up shots and reduced shooter fatigue during extended engagements.

Question 6: Are there legal restrictions on owning 300 AAC?

Regulations vary by jurisdiction; many regions treat 300 AAC as a standard rifle cartridge, but certain areas may impose limits on subsonic ammunition or suppressor use.

Tips for Maximizing AAC Blackout Performance

Tip 1: Match barrel length to mission. Short barrels excel in confined spaces, while longer barrels improve supersonic velocity and accuracy.

Tip 2: Use dedicated subsonic magazines. Specialized magazines reduce feeding issues caused by heavier projectiles.

Tip 3: Select appropriate twist rates. Faster twists stabilize heavy subsonic bullets; slower twists favor lighter supersonic loads.

Tip 4: Clean the gas system regularly. Consistent gas flow prevents malfunctions when switching between load types.

Tip 5: Verify powder charges with a calibrated scale. Accurate loads maintain safety and performance.

Tip 6: Pair with a suppressor designed for subsonic flow. This maximizes decibel reduction and extends suppressor life.

Tip 7: Store ammunition in a cool, dry environment. Proper storage preserves ballistic consistency.

Tip 8: Conduct live‑fire testing after any component change. Real‑world data confirms reliability before deployment.

Tip 9: Use high‑BC bullets for supersonic engagements. Enhanced aerodynamic efficiency retains energy at distance.

Tip 10: Keep a balanced loadout of subsonic and supersonic magazines. Flexibility ensures readiness for varied scenarios.

Tip 11: Monitor barrel temperature during sustained fire. Overheating can affect pressure and accuracy.

Tip 12: Employ a reliable optic with adjustable parallax. Accurate sight picture improves hit probability across ranges.

Tip 13: Record performance data in a logbook. Tracking trends aids in fine‑tuning load configurations.

Tip 14: Stay informed about regulatory changes. Compliance ensures uninterrupted operation and ownership.
